Got this today and it is my first time getting a case for the AirPods in one year of owning them.
the fit is not bad, I was apprehensive with reviews stating it would give a muffin-top look to the AirPods. It is thin, and feels really good. Best feeling leather out of all 3.
I am looking forward to the patina, it does crease easy, the leather is soft without a plastic shell behind and I have crease marks during install/reinstall already.

So this is how my around 1 year old case looked like vs my new case.
I wanted to get a case to try and see if I like it, at $40+ This is more expensive than an apple care incident @ $29.
Silicone ones were bleh.
Nomad has excellent fit but the color, plastic, and bulk made me steer away.
Only product left was this native union which involved a luck of the draw to get a well fitting case.
I am still not sold on this case idea.
It feels better than plastic, but at the same time pinches, and doesn’t fit perfect. Plus, leather is a material that has to be replaced, I use leather wipes but i do not see the value in spending $40 repeatedly when I can get a new case for $29.
